    WVHC (91.5 FM) is a radio station broadcasting a variety format. Licensed to Herkimer, New York, United States, the station is owned by Herkimer County Community College and operated by the college's Radio/TV Department.

    WXXI (1370 kHz) is a non-commercial AM radio station in Rochester, New York. It broadcasts news, talk and informational programming as a member station of National Public Radio (NPR). WXXI, along with WXXI-FM (105.9), WXXO (91.5 FM), and WXXI-TV (channel 21), are owned by the WXXI Public Broadcasting Council .

    WSQX-FM is an NPR member radio station in south-central New York State. It operates in Binghamton, New York, on 91.5 MHz (), and has an effective radiated power of 3.5 kW.The signal is repeated in Greene by WSQN 88.1 MHz, in Corning by translator station W214AA on 90.7 MHz, and in Cooperstown by translator station W290CI on 105.9 MHz.
